Overview of LLCs in the US

Limited Liability Companies, or limited liability companies, have emerged as a prevalent entity type in the U.S. due to their versatility and the security they offer to their stakeholders. An LLC merges the advantages of both incorporated entities and individual ownership, permitting for individual asset protection while maintaining a less formal operational structure. This feature is notably attractive to entrepreneurs who want to shield their individual wealth from business debts and legal actions.

The formation of an LLC varies by region, which indicates that the requirements and regulations can vary significantly. For instance, when conducting a search for Texas LLC, one might find particular filing fees and documentation necessary to create a LLC in that location. Similarly, Florida limited liability company lookup and Wyoming LLC search will reveal unique rules and processes tailored to each region's legal framework. Comprehending these variations is vital for business owners looking to navigate the intricacies of LLC creation.

Furthermore, the benefits of an LLC reach outside of legal shielding. Shareholders can gain from flow-through taxation, meaning profits and losses are reported on their personal tax returns, preventing the dual taxation faced by conventional businesses. This presents a distinct edge for numerous entrepreneurs. Overall, the design of an LLC offers both security and flexibility, making it an appealing option for numerous people and companies across the United States.

Finding The Sunshine State Limited Liability Company Lookup

Conducting a Florida Limited Liability Company search is an integral step for entrepreneurs aiming to establish their ventures in the state of Florida. The Division of Corporations in Florida maintains an digital portal where individuals can easily search for existing LLCs using the name of the business or the name of the registered agent. This lookup helps to verify that the preferred business name is available and not already in service by another business.

When utilizing the Florida LLC search, it's crucial for users to comprehend the information that is typically available through the search results. Besides the company name, the search results will generally include the status of the LLC, its date established, and the designation and address of its registered agent.  structured business database  is important for confirming the legitimacy of the company and for prospective partners or clients looking to engage with it.

Moreover, the Florida Limited Liability Company search gives the opportunity to examine not only functioning entities but also those that may have been not active or dissolved. This broader view aids in making educated decisions regarding financial commitments or collaborations. By examining the previous data associated with an Limited Liability Company, entrepreneurs can pinpoint potential risks and opportunities in the industry.

Common Difficulties in LLC Searches

LLC investigations can usually lead to unforeseen issues for business proprietors and business developers. One of the primary challenges is the discrepancy in state regulations and naming rules. Each region, be it Texas, has its own unique requirements for LLC creation and naming. This suggests that a name that is open in one state could be taken or barred in another, complicating the search process. Grasping these variations is crucial for anyone wanting to form a corporation effectively.

Another major hurdle is the risk for outdated or incomplete data in state databases. Many individuals rely on internet searches to gather critical information about existing entities, but these databases may not consistently be up to date. This can result in inaccurate data regarding the status of an LLC, leading to confusion about its availability or conformity. Without thorough checks, business owners may accidentally proceed with corporate establishment under incorrect notions.

Lastly, the extensive nature of searches across various states can bewilder those not experienced with the nuances of LLC registrations. Performing a thorough-going search across several states, especially in regions with many active LLCs, can be time-consuming and complicated. Entrepreneurs may need conduct various investigations or utilize professional assistance to ensure they have the best and pertinent information, adding to the overall work and expense involved in starting a new business.
